Recently, an O(3) type of effective action was proposed for the quantum Hall ferromagnet, which accounts for bag formation observed in microscopic Hartree- Fock calculations. We apply this action in the soliton sector and compare with Hartree-Fock results. We find good agreement over the whole parameter range where skyrmions exist. The standard minimal O(3) model cannot explain the bag and has further shortcomings connected with that fact.
